The Psychology of the Crossing: Why We’re Hooked

The inherent tension within the game – the constant threat of vehicular impact juxtaposed with the desire for maximizing score – taps into a primal part of the human brain. It's a low-stakes environment to experience a controlled dose of adrenaline and test reaction time. The short, focused bursts of gameplay are perfect for filling idle moments, fitting seamlessly into modern, on-the-go lifestyles. Players find a sense of mastery in learning the timing of traffic flows and the optimal routes for collecting bonuses. This gradual improvement fosters a feeling of competence and achievement, driving continued engagement. Moreover, the visual simplicity of the gameplay is a key contributor to its broad appeal; the rules are immediately understandable, requiring no lengthy tutorials or complex instructions.

Navigating the Hazards: Strategies for Survival

While the premise of guiding a chicken across a road might seem simplistic, mastering the game requires a degree of strategic thinking and honed reflexes. Observing traffic patterns is paramount. Players must learn to anticipate the speed and trajectory of oncoming vehicles, identifying safe windows for crossing. Focusing on the gaps between cars is crucial, but also being aware of the speed at which those gaps are closing. Dodging isn't just about reacting to immediate threats; it's about predicting them. Furthermore, skilled players often prioritize collecting coins without sacrificing safety, finding a balance between risk and reward. The ability to quickly assess a situation and make split-second decisions is key to achieving high scores and prolonged survival. Consistent practice is the most effective method for improving these skills.

The Evolution of the Road Crossing Genre

The original concept of a chicken crossing the road has undergone numerous iterations and reinventions since its inception. Early versions were often simple, pixelated experiences with limited features. However, modern iterations have benefited from advances in mobile technology and game design, incorporating more sophisticated graphics, dynamic environments, and engaging gameplay mechanics. Many games now feature multiple lanes of traffic with varying speeds, challenging obstacles, and a wider range of collectible items. Online leaderboards and social features have also become increasingly common, fostering a sense of community and competition among players. The introduction of diverse character options beyond just chickens – including ducks, penguins, and even fantastical creatures – has broadened the appeal of the genre.

Monetization Models in Chicken Road Games

While many iterations of this game are free-to-play, developers employ various monetization strategies to generate revenue. The most common approach involves in-app purchases, allowing players to purchase coins, gems, or other virtual currencies to unlock customizations, power-ups, or remove advertisements. Rewarded video ads are also prevalent, offering players the opportunity to earn bonus rewards in exchange for watching short video clips. While these monetization methods can be effective, it’s crucial for developers to strike a balance between revenue generation and player experience. An overly aggressive monetization strategy can detract from the enjoyment of the game and lead to negative reviews.
